    EP249 The Hidden Hazards: CO, H₂S and the Tech Behind Modern Gas Detection With Dave Massner from Sensorcon (December 2025)

    Episode quotes: "Hydrogen sulfide doesn't announce itself. It can drift in, hit your mucus membranes, and start causing real harm before you know it's there." "You can't treat sensor response like magic—it's physics, chemistry, and smart filtering working together to tell you what's actually happening in the space." In this episode, Bill & Eric sit down with Dave Massner from Sensorcon, a long-time technical contributor in the world of portable gas detection, to dig into the realities behind CO, H₂S, and O₂ sensing in both HVAC and industrial environments. Bill recaps the origins of their relationship with Sensorcon, which sets the stage for Dave to explain why gas detection still matters and brings in real-world examples—from oil fields to everyday equipment rooms—to show how invisible hazards shape how techs should approach safety. The conversation explores lesser-understood threats like hydrogen sulfide (H₂S)—a gas that can travel with the wind in oil and gas regions and incapacitate workers before they realize it's there. We discuss the physiology, the chemistry, and the grim speed at which exposure can become deadly. From there, we shift to oxygen depletion, clarifying what "too low" actually means in field work and why measuring O₂ is just as important as detecting toxic gases. The episode also gets into the nuts and bolts of sensor behavior: signal-to-noise ratios, filtering, raw output, response time, and the clever algorithms that help instruments stabilize faster without sacrificing accuracy. Toward the end, we highlight Sensorcon's ongoing efforts in training, education, and transparency, pointing listeners to the company's technical blog posts, videos, and calibration resources. We also make the case for low-level CO alarms and why TruTech Tools has championed them for over a decade. As we wrap up, we leave listeners with a simple takeaway: understand your sensors, understand your risks, and choose equipment that treats safety as something more than a checkbox.     EP248 Balanced Comfort, Brutal Lessons: Scaling, Losing Half Your Revenue, and Starting Over with AI with Aaron Husak (November 2025)

    "Inspect your marketing the way you'd inspect a home—run diagnostics, don't guess." – Aaron Husak "Attitude is way more important than aptitude. One bad apple really can infect the whole company." – Aaron Husak In this episode of the Building HVAC Science podcast, Eric and Bill sit down with long-time friend and contractor-turned-marketing pro, Aaron Husak. Aaron traces his winding path from solar in the mid-2000s to building performance and BPI training, and then to founding Balanced Comfort in Fresno, CA. What started as a small HERS and energy-audit firm bootstrapped its way into insulation, HVAC, and weatherization, eventually landing on the Inc. 5000 list four times and scaling from $1.3M to over $12M in just a few years. Along the way, Aaron learned the complex realities of rapid growth: hiring quickly, depending on rebate programs, uncovering serious gaps in back-office accounting and HR, and navigating California's legal landscape. Things got especially rough when PG&E abruptly pulled a weatherization program that made up half of their revenue, right as Aaron was also dealing with the personal loss of both his parents. A rescue buyer ultimately acquired the company in early 2025, giving Aaron a hard-earned exit. From that experience, Aaron pulls out lessons for contractors who want to grow without blowing themselves up. He emphasizes perseverance, but also warns that good field tech screening doesn't automatically translate into good screening for accountants, HR, and support staff. He talks about the cost of keeping the wrong people too long, the importance of outside eyes on your books and compliance, and why attitude beats aptitude when building a healthy culture. He also calls out how easy it is to underestimate the impact of programs, receivables, and legal exposure—especially in states where "it doesn't matter if you're right, you still have to pay the attorney." Today, Aaron has pivoted into his next chapter with Sequoia GEO, a marketing firm focused on contractors and local service businesses, with a special emphasis on AI and "GEO" (Generative Engine Optimization). He explains why your Google Business Profile is the low-hanging fruit almost everyone neglects, how AI tools and devices like Plaud can turn field conversations into high-value website content, and why AI "likes structure" (bullets, lists, and real stories). The episode closes with practical advice: inspect your marketing like you would inspect a home, use affordable diagnostic tools to see what's really happening online, stay transparent with customers about recording and privacy, and treat expensive mistakes as lessons that tighten your processes for the future.     EP246 Beyond MERV: The Truth About Smoke, Sensors, and Standards With Sissi Liu (October 2025)

    Episode quotes: "Below about 0.4 microns, many low-cost PM sensors are basically guessing—right where wildfire smoke and aerosols live." — Sissi Liu "Electrostatic filters can look great at first—and then fall off a cliff in smoke. Pressure drop won't warn you." — Sissi Liu "Science is a way of thinking much more than it is a body of knowledge." — Carl Sagan   Eric digs into the "fresh air" myth with Sissi Liu, CEO/co-founder of Metalmark Innovations and active ASHRAE committee member. Sissi explains why "outdoor = fresh" is context-dependent—urban pollution, agricultural activity, and especially wildfire smoke can make outdoor air worse than indoor air. Because air quality is dynamic, she pushes for comparing indoor and outdoor conditions in real time and ventilating intelligently, with attention to the energy cost of conditioning outside air. They then get nerdy on sensors and filters. Many low-cost PM2.5 laser-scattering sensors struggle below ~0.4 µm and can misread certain particle types (e.g., dark/black carbon), which matters because smoke and pathogen-carrying aerosols often live in the ~0.1–0.3 µm range. On filtration, Sissi contrasts mechanical vs. electrostatically charged media: electrostatic filters start efficiently with low pressure drop but can lose effectiveness within hours in smoke events. In contrast, mechanical media hold up better (though at higher pressure). She highlights ASHRAE 52.2 Appendix J (loaded efficiency) and argues that standards—along with reporting practices—must evolve for wildfire realities. Key takeaways "Fresh air" is conditional: check outdoor AQ (and indoor) before cranking up ventilation. IAQ is dynamic; test and compare locally rather than assuming static conditions. Consumer PM sensors can under-count the tiniest and darkest particles; treat data with caveats. Wildfire smoke clusters in the most-penetrating particle size (~0.1–0.3 µm) for many filters. Electrostatic filters may degrade fast in smoke; pressure drop alone won't reveal failure. ASHRAE standards (e.g., 52.2 Appendix J, SGPC-44) are evolving—industry needs to catch up.     EP245 Retrofit the Future: Inside PHIUS's New Revive Standard with Al Mitchell and Haley Harlow (October 2025)

    Eric Kaiser sits down with Haley Harlow and Al Mitchell from PHIUS (Passive House Institute US) to explore Revive 2024, a groundbreaking new retrofit standard focused on thermal resilience and healthier, safer existing buildings. Haley shares her path from Pennsylvania College of Technology to her current role managing building certifications at PHIUS. At the same time, Al recounts his journey from aspiring car engineer to building scientist, drawn to the elegant complexity of whole-building systems. Together, they unpack how Revive differs from traditional PHIUS new-construction standards. Instead of focusing on heating and cooling load targets, Revive emphasizes thermal resilience—a building's ability to remain habitable for up to a week during power outages or extreme weather. They also discuss ReviveCalc, PHIUS's new software tool for analyzing retrofit scenarios, allowing designers to test various upgrade packages, balance cost and performance, and phase improvements over time. The tool incorporates lifecycle cost analysis, dynamic energy modeling, and resilience metrics, making advanced design decisions more accessible to real-world projects. Both guests share their excitement about addressing the massive stock of underperforming existing buildings. Haley connects it to her own experience growing up in energy-intensive apartments, while Al reflects on how to use today's computing power better to design resilient, efficient homes. They close with a shared message: retrofitting our current buildings is not only possible, it's essential for the future of sustainability, comfort, and community resilience. Key Takeaways PHIUS Revive 2024 focuses on retrofits, bringing resilience and energy equity to the existing building stock. Thermal resilience replaces traditional load metrics, ensuring buildings remain habitable during grid or system failures. ReviveCalc helps users model envelope and mechanical upgrades, estimate lifecycle costs, and optimize phase-by-phase improvements. The program aligns with ASHRAE Guideline 0.2 for commissioning and integrates EPA's Energy Savings Plus Health framework. Air sealing remains the top "bang for the buck" retrofit measure for both comfort and energy savings. CPHC certification (Certified PHIUS Consultant) is open to anyone—no degree required. The Revive approach balances performance, cost, and practicality for real-world projects.     EP244 Envelope, HVAC, and Humans: Solving the IAQ Puzzle with Brantley May (October 2025)

    Quotes by Brantley: "Most moisture problems are a three-way dance—envelope, mechanicals, and the occupants."   "Skim the light, don't blast it. The right flashlight technique makes the invisible visible."   "If you only understand one piece of the system, you're solving 1/3 of the problem."   Indoor environmental specialist Brantley May joins the show to unpack how he investigates moisture, mold, and air-quality problems through building forensics. Starting as a mold remediator in his family business, Brantley shifted to assessment work and now runs national investigations that pinpoint root causes—from envelope leaks and interstitial space connections to mechanical design and operation issues. He explains the value of "flashlight technique" (skimming light across surfaces to reveal early hyaline mold) and why good eyes, a light, and critical thinking are still the most important tools in the bag.   Brantley walks through his toolkit—manometers, blower doors, pressure pans, thermal imagers, moisture meters, anemometers/flow hoods, data loggers, and even a backup sling psychrometer—plus his new favorite screening instrument, the InstaScope, which provides real-time readings on particulates, mold/pollen, bacteria/virus, VOCs, and CO₂. Investigations culminate in a report and protocols for the envelope, mechanicals, and remediation, often requiring tight coordination across multiple trades. He stresses pre-drywall inspections, "red-pen" continuous air/thermal barrier checks, and long-term monitoring to verify theories—especially on complex modern designs where vented attics and interstitial spaces end up unintentionally connected.   A major theme: cross-disciplinary literacy. Most condensation/humidity problems stem from three interacting factors—envelope failure, mechanical failure, and occupant behavior—so HVAC pros must understand building science, and envelope pros must understand HVAC. Brantley shares how training (BPI, IICRC), mentorship, microscopy work (McCrone/Ochsner), and relentless curiosity shaped his practice.     EP243 Three Sensors, One Strategy: Making Maintenance Truly Smart With Kevin Weaver from SmartAC (October 2025)

    Episode Quotes from Kevin Weaver:   "If we can quantify delivered capacity on the air side, we can work our way back to what's happening on the refrigerant side."    "We don't have to diagnose everything remotely — we have to be great at saying, 'there's a problem,' and prioritizing action."    "Even the best design can be wrecked at installation. Execution matters."    Chief Engineering Officer Kevin Weaver joins Eric and Bill to go beyond "remote monitoring" and explain how SmartAC is really a loyalty and trade-intelligence platform for residential HVAC. With three simple wireless sensors — a supply-air "comfort" sensor (temp/RH), a filter sensor (temp/static pressure), and a water sensor — plus a cloud-connected hub, SmartAC tracks delivered capacity and trends changes over time. That minimum viable data set lets contractors catch problems early, prioritize the right calls, and give homeowners peace of mind without needing full remote gauges.   Kevin walks through the contractor toolset, which includes a white-labeled homeowner app, a Pro app for technicians, and a partner dashboard that also integrates with Field Service Management. (FSM) systems like ServiceTitan. The result is fewer emergency visits, healthier memberships, and durable customer relationships (i.e., less ad spend, more lifetime value). He previews Gen-2 hardware (more sensing in more places, stronger radios), battery options (18 months on AA lithiums or 5–8 years with a long-life pack), and notes that SmartAC is approaching 100k homes sold — building one of the most extensive residential HVAC data sets for richer insights across brands, geographies, and system types.   We conclude with wisdom from Kevin's Texas A&M research: even great designs can fail due to poor execution. Right-size returns, stretch flex, use collars and mastic, and keep static in check.
